Part of the BMS' job is to prevent damage to Lithium cells by allowing them to suffer deep-discharges. Not unlike a car battery, Empty ≠ zero voltage, or anything below ~3V. Conversely, allowing them to be stored at full charge is also not optimum for best lifetime.

Lithium cells like to operate within a narrow voltage range, and though often ignored in real world practical usage, the best practice is to keep them between 20-80% SoC if better durability is a desired goal.

That said, they should be "exercised" and run through a complete cycle occasionally, for their health, and to keep the BMS happy. Keeping that laptop that only does desk duty connected to AC power all the time does no favors to its battery.
